I'd like to formally petition Uniden to change a couple things about how P25
is handled in their D radios. Upgradeable firmware...very nice!
1. P25 Encryption: Why in the world would I like to listen to encrypted
P25? Right now, the scanner will stop on encrypted P25 and sit there
blasting out junk until the transmission ends. I propose the firmware be
changed so that in scan mode, the Encryption bit (or whatever turns on the
ENC indicator) makes the scanning (and searching?) continue. At most, the
scanner should stop long enough to trigger the beep alert so we can tell if
someone is using the freq.
2. P25 versus PL: Right now the scanner must not have a PL entered for a
frequency if you want it to stop on P25 audio. That's fine except now I
have to deal with listening to other systems and images on the freq when I
ONLY want to hear P25 on it. No choice. I propose a firmware change so
that there is a 4th choice (#3 here) for TONE DATA; 1:CTCSS, 2:DCS,
3:P25-ONLY, 4:OFF.
